Prerequisite: AHEA 1130; AHEA 1140; TECH 1110 or TECH 1120 or MATH 1111 This course introduces drug therapy with emphasis on safety, classification of drugs, their action, side effects, and/or adverse reactions. Also introduces the basic concept of mathematics used in the administration of drugs. Topics include introduction to pharmacology, calculation of dosages, sources and forms of drugs, drug classification, and drug effects on the body systems. This class can NOT be used for credit toward the LPN program of study (LPNU 1120).
